Xtrackers US National Critical Technologies ETF (NYSEARCA:CRTC – Get Free Report) saw a significant growth in short interest in June. As of June 15th, there was short interest totaling 15,559 shares, a growth of 321.5% from the May 31st total of 3,691 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 7,873 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 2.0 days. Approximately 0.5% of the shares of the company are sold short.
